Excluir buckets de armazenamento

Nesta página, você vai aprender a excluir buckets de armazenamento em ambientes de dispositivos isolados do Google Distributed Cloud (GDC). Ele aborda pré-requisitos e métodos para excluir buckets usando o console e a interface de linha de comando (CLI) do GDC. Saiba como excluir buckets com políticas de retenção usando a trituração criptográfica, um processo em que você exclui a chave de criptografia associada ao bucket de armazenamento. Essas informações permitem gerenciar de forma segura e permanente o ciclo de vida do armazenamento de objetos, oferecendo higiene e conformidade de dados.

Esta página é destinada a públicos-alvo como administradores de TI no grupo de operadores de infraestrutura ou desenvolvedores no grupo de operadores de aplicativos responsáveis por gerenciar recursos de armazenamento de objetos em ambientes isolados do GDC.

Antes de começar

Um namespace de projeto gerencia recursos de bucket no servidor da API Management. Você precisa ter um projeto para trabalhar com buckets e objetos.

Você também precisa ter as permissões de bucket adequadas para realizar a seguinte operação. Consulte Conceder acesso ao bucket.

É possível excluir buckets de armazenamento usando a CLI kubectl. Os buckets precisam estar vazios antes de serem excluídos.

  1. Use o comando GET ou DESCRIBE para receber o nome totalmente qualificado do bucket.

  2. Se o bucket não estiver vazio, esvazie-o:

    gdcloud storage rm --recursive s3://FULLY_QUALIFIED_BUCKET_NAME
    
  3. Exclua o bucket vazio:

    kubectl delete buckets/BUCKET_NAME --namespace NAMESPACE_NAME